Er diagram symbols in dbms software

Er diagram tutorial covering everything you need to learn about entity relationship diagrams. Generalization, specialization and aggregation in er model are used for data abstraction in which abstraction mechanism is used to hide details of a set of objects. The gliffy er diagram tool allows you to easily illustrate how entities relate to one another, making database modeling simple and efficient. The main data objects are termed as entities, with their details defined as attributes, some of these attributes are important and are used to identity the. But they can also be used to illustrate relationships among people, places or objects in a system. Even though fundamentally a exact straightforward structure. If you want to design a plan for a database that isnt set up yet or dont have access to the data, smartdraw can help you create entity relationship diagrams. Generalization generalization is the process of extracting common properties from a set of entities and create a generalized entity from it.

Navicat data modeler is a database design tool which helps you build conceptual, logical and physical data models. We will also see some extended features on er diagrams specialization, generalization and aggregation. Data modeling using the entityrelationship er model. All the real world objects like a book, an organization, a product, a car, a person are the examples of an entity.

Rectangles are named with the entity set they represent. Erd diagram symbols er is a substantialstage conceptual information model diagram. All notational styles represent entities as rectangular boxes and. Get the notes of all important topics of database management system subject. Above i have listed the 5 best free online er diagram tool 2020.

This page gathers a large quantity of useful symbols that often used. These concepts are used when the comes in eer schema and the resulting schema diagrams called. Basic concepts of er model in dbms as we described in the tutorial database models, entityrelationship model is a model used for design and representation of relationships between data. Any object, for example, entities, attributes of an entity, relationship sets, and attributes of relationship sets. In this article, we will discuss what are er diagram, er diagrams symbols, notations, their various components like entity. Pick any of the er diagram templates included and customize it with your own. An entity may be an object with a physical existence a. Learn about er diagram symbols, how to draw er diagrams, best practices to follow. Dbms notation for er diagram with dbms overview, dbms vs files system, dbms architecture, three schema architecture, dbms language, dbms keys, dbms generalization, dbms. Lucidchart is the essential erd tool to quickly differentiate relationships, entities, and their attributes.

That page probably was not there when this question was asked but now there are. Sometimes when im working with eer diagrams i see different symbols, for example, d, o, u and so on. Create a database model also known as entity relationship. In this post, we will learn about different component, symbols and notations used in er diagram in dbms. Apr 30, 2020 entity relationship diagram displays the relationships of entity set stored in a database. Nov 05, 2014 illustration on er model to relational tables 1 database management system. An erd contains different symbols and connectors that. Entityrelationship diagram symbols and notation lucidchart. An entityrelationship model er model describes the structure of a database with the help of a diagram, which is known as entity relationship diagram er. Draw even the most complex of data designs easily with createlys intuitive features. In this database, the student will be an entity with attributes like address, name, id, age, etc. Learn about er diagram symbols, how to draw er diagrams, best practices to follow when drawing er diagrams and much more.

These concepts are used when the comes in eer schema and the resulting schema diagrams called as eer diagrams. Check out this guide for a comprehensive look at all er diagram symbols and notation. Eer is a highlevel data model that incorporates the extensions to the original er model. You will learn things like what is erd, why erd, erd notations, how to draw. Entity relationship diagram, also known as erd, er diagram or er model, is a type of structural diagram for use in database design. An er diagram is a means of visualizing how the information a system produces is related. Working with er diagrams er diagram is a visual representation of data that describes how data is related to each other. If you want to design a plan for a database that isnt set up yet or dont have access to the data, smartdraw can help you create entity relationship diagrams erd manually too with built in templates and intuitive, but powerful tools. That page probably was not there when this question was asked but now there are web pages such as that with the material. In software engineering, an er model is commonly formed to represent things a business needs to remember in order to perform business processes. Type the path and file name for the model that you want to import, or click the browse button to locate the model file, and then click open.

Modeling your data using entityrelationship diagram erd with crows foot notation which is popular in structured systems analysis, barkers notations, design methods and information engineering you need the software that is easy in use having all necessary elements for creating the needed flowcharts as well as their examples. Er diagrams are translatable into relational tables which allows you to build databases quickly. Entityconnection design is dependant on the idea of actualplanet entities along with. Intuitive drag drop interface with a contextual toolbar for effortless drawing. Conceptdraw diagram v12 software extended with flowcharts solution from the what is a diagram area is a powerful software that will help you design the flowcharts for any business and technical processes, and software. An entity is an object or concept about which you want to store information. Entity relationship diagram symbols mind map software. Drawing er diagrams with dia tool using chen notation. Now its your turn to select the one from the above tool and make the perfect entity relationship diagram. The entityrelationship er model chapter 7 6e chapter 3 5e lecture outline using highlevel, conceptual data models for database design entityrelationship er model. Er diagrams and eer diagrams are helpful tools when designing a database or a conceptual er diagram uses six standard symbols. Er model is used to model the logical view of the system from data perspective which consists of these components.

The address can be another entity with attributes like city, street name, pin code, etc and. Summary of symbols used in er notation representing attributes 29. Any realworld object can be represented as an entity about which data can be stored in a database. In other words, we can say that er diagrams help you to explain the logical structure of databases. The socalled semantic modeling method nowadays is commonly used in database structure design. This page gathers a large quantity of useful symbols that often used in er diagrams, chen erd, expressg diagram, orm diagram, martin erd and database model diagram. In er modeling, the database structure is portrayed as a diagram called an entityrelationship diagram. Modeling your data using entityrelationship diagram erd with crows foot notation which is popular in structured systems analysis, barkers notations. Appropriate er model design choose names that convey meanings attached to various constructs.

You will get the toolbox for er components entity, relationship, attribute, lines shown on the left side. Database creation and patching visual paradigm, an erd tool, supports a. Er diagram symbols and notations components of an er diagram. Plus create, smart connectors, preset styling options and a full er diagram shape library. Database diagram reverse engineering tools dbms tools.

You can also modify the symbol size, color and text according to your specific requirements. An entity relationship model is generated through er diagram i. These notes will be helpful in preparing for semester exams and competitive exams like gate, net and psus. Entity relationship diagrams erd are used to model databases and information systems. Professionallydesigned er diagram examples to kickstart your projects. When you need to create an er diagram to document a database, it will. Arnab chakraborty, tutorials point india private limited. Erd uber funktionen desselben systems unterstutzt wird.

Any object, for example, entities, attributes of an entity, relationship sets, and attributes of relationship sets, can be represented with the help of an er diagram. If you wish to get this diagram, simply click the image straight away and do as the way. An erd contains different symbols and connectors that visualize two important information. It allows you to visually design database structures, perform reverseforward engineering processes, import models from odbc data sources, generate complex sqlddl, print models to files. Entityrelationship diagrams erd are essential to modeling anything from simple to complex databases, but the shapes and notations used can be very confusing. In terms of dbms, an entity is a table or attribute. Entity relationship diagram erd, a database design tool that provides graphical representation of database tables, their columns and interrelationships. Learn about er diagram symbols, how to draw er diagrams, best practices to follow when. Dbms diagram entity relationship can be a substantialstage conceptual info product diagram. Generalization, specialization and aggregation in er model. We have already seen some basic concepts about er model in database in previous posts.

When you need to create an er diagram to document a database, it will be much easier using premade symbols and icons. The database designer gains a better understanding of the information to be contained in the database with the help of erp diagram. An entityrelationship model or er model describes interrelated things of interest in a specific. Relational database symbols this is probably the types of er diagram. An entityrelationship er diagram is used to show the structure of a business database. Jan 24, 2018 dbms symbols in erdiagram watch more videos at lecture by. Illustration on er model to relational tables 1 database management system. Dbms notation for er diagram with dbms overview, dbms vs files system, dbms architecture, three schema architecture, dbms language, dbms keys, dbms generalization, dbms specialization, relational model concept, sql introduction, advantage of sql, dbms normalization, functional dependency, dbms schedule, concurrency control etc. Er diagrams are used to sketch out the design of a database. Entity relationship symbols below are predrawn entity relationship symbols in edraw er diagram software, including entity, view, parent to category, category to child, dynamic connector, line connector, strong entity, weak entity, strong relationship, weak relationship, attribute, derived attribute, constraint and participation, etc.

Er diagram symbols an er diagram is composed of several components and each component in er diagram is represented using a specific symbol. With dedicated shape libraries, drag and drop standard erd symbols onto the canvas within seconds. Different variants of the entityrelationship diagrams are used as a tool for the semantic modeling. Entityconnection design is dependant on the idea of actualplanet entities along with the relationship between the two. Introduction er diagram is a visual representation of data that describes how data is related to each other. Er diagram is the short form of entityrelationship diagram. This guide will help you to become an expert in er diagram notation, and you will be well on your way to model your own database. An er diagram shows the relationship among entity sets.

On the file menu, point to new, point to software and database, and then click database model diagram. Dbms symbols in erdiagram watch more videos at lecture by. As an aside, the barkerellis notation, used in oracle designer, uses. Erd represents data as objects entities that are connected with standard relationships symbols which illustrate an association between entities. On the database menu, point to import, and then click import. Erd symbols and meanings project management software. Eer creates a design more accurate to database schemas. An er diagram efficiently shows the relationships between various entities stored in a database. Entityrelation design is founded on the notion of realentire world entities as well as the relationship between the two. Physical er diagram symbols the physical data model is the most granular level of entityrelationship diagrams, and represents the process of adding information to the database. For entity sets an entity set is a set of same type of entities.

If you would like have this diagram, simply click the image immediately and do as how it clarifies. Creating er diagram representation in dbms studytonight. In er model, we disintegrate data into entities, attributes and setup. Relational database symbols this is probably the examples of er diagram.

Basic concepts of er model in dbms as we described in the tutorial database models, entityrelationship model is a model used for design and representation of relationships between. The symbols are right in the software library pane, which can be used through draganddrop. Data modeling, object modeling, process modeling, structured analysisdesign popkin software system architect 2001 developer 2000 and database modeling, application development. There is no standard for representing data objects in er diagrams. A welldeveloped erd can provide sufficient information for database administrator to follow when developing and maintaining database.

However, er diagram includes many specialized symbols, and its. An entity may be an object with a physical existence a particular person, car, house, or employee or it may be an object with a conceptual existence a company, a job, or a university course. Apr 30, 2019 er diagram tutorial covering everything you need to learn about entity relationship diagrams. Even though fundamentally a exact straightforward structure, many different contours and linking lines, and also rules and actions pertaining to these, make the block diagram a more versatile instrument for a variety of. Get started right away with editable er diagram templates. In er model, we disintegrate data into entities, attributes and setup relationships between entities, all this can be represented visually using the er diagram.

Er modeling helps you to analyze data demands systematically to make a welldesigned data bank. At first look, an er diagram looks very similar to the flowchart. In terms of dbms, an entity is a table or attribute of a table in database, so by showing relationship among tables and their attributes, er diagram shows the complete logical structure of a database. Entity relationship diagrams erd are used to model. Physical er models show all table structures, including column name, column data type, column constraints, primary key, foreign key, and relationships between tables. Our er diagram tool simplifies database modeling, whether your erds are conceptual or physical. Edraw er diagram software has the ability to create nice er diagrams not only through built in symbols, but also with professional tools, templates and examples. Entity relationship diagram symbols about entityrelationship diagram. Let us now learn how the er model is represented by means of an er diagram.

Er diagram entity relationship diagram dbms tutorial. Er diagram in dbms components, symbol and notations. In er diagram, many notations are used to express the cardinality. However, er diagram includes many specialized symbols, and its meanings make this model. With dedicated shape libraries, drag and drop standard erd symbols onto the canvas within. In other words, we can say that er diagrams help you to explain the logical structure. Database sign icon relational database schema stock vector regarding relational database symbols. Extensive predrawn er diagram symbols are provided with vector.

It reflects the data properties and constraints more precisely. See more complex examples of er notation in order to fully discover how to create this important document. Er diagram tutorial complete guide to entity relationship. Er diagrams can be used by database designers as a blueprint for implementing data in specific software applications. The major entities within the system scope, and the interrelationships among these entities. An entity set is a group of similar entities and these entities can have attributes.

Entity relationship diagram erd what is an er diagram. Er diagram usage history of er diagrams er diagrams symbols and notations how to draw er diagrams er diagram templates benefits of er diagrams er diagrams usage while able to. Er modeling helps you to evaluate data demands systematically to generate a nicelycreated data bank. Entity relationship diagram example for bus reservation. It allows you to visually design database structures, perform. Below are pre drawn entity relationship symbols in edraw er diagram software. Entity relationship diagram displays the relationships of entity set stored in a database.

216 497 1588 546 1669 643 1589 1364 417 342 781 698 159 1547 955 1311 996 719 758 1133 586 247 489 23 1393 427 1612 1345 1324 1338 905 147 41 382 748 273 427